      Panasonic DMP-BD10

      By Matthew Moskovciak

      Review summary: While most people are plenty satisfied with DVD, home theater enthusiasts are getting geared up for the next generation of disc-based video formats, Blu-ray and HD-DVD, which compete directly against one another. While HD-DVD won the first round ...

      Cons: Very expensive ; terrible remote ; annoying front flip-down panel on unit ; relatively slow load times ; no HDMI 1.3

      Verdict: The Panasonic DMP-BD10 is a very competent first-generation Blu-ray player, but its high price and the comparably affordable PlayStation 3 make it hard to recommend.

      Panasonic DMP-BD10: Blu-ray -- the sequel

      By Rob Gillman

      Pros: Picture quality

      Cons: Dull looks ; far too expensive ; so-so DVD upscaling ; rubbish remote

      Verdict: £1,100 is far too expensive for this at the moment, but look beyond the price and dreary styling and you've got the best Blu-ray player on the market. True, it's only the second -- but the picture quality with certain discs is stunning
